数据库文件双备份:确保数据安全之策
数据库文件双备份是什么

首页 2025-04-01 00:37:45



数据库文件双备份:确保数据安全的坚固防线 在信息化高速发展的今天,数据已成为企业最宝贵的资产之一

    无论是金融、电子商务、大数据应用,还是其他关键业务系统,数据的可靠性和可用性都是企业持续运营和市场竞争力的基石

    然而,硬件故障、自然灾害、人为误操作、网络攻击等风险时刻威胁着数据的安全

    为了有效应对这些挑战,数据库文件双备份策略应运而生,成为企业保障数据安全的重要手段

     一、数据库文件双备份的定义与重要性 数据库文件双备份,顾名思义,就是将数据库的数据和日志文件备份到两个不同的位置或设备上

    这一策略的核心目的在于防止单点故障导致的数据丢失或不可用,从而提高数据的可靠性和可用性

     数据可靠性提高:双备份策略能够保护数据免受硬件故障、自然灾害等物理因素的影响

    当某一备份设备或位置发生故障时,企业可以迅速切换到另一个备份源,确保数据的连续性和完整性

     数据可用性增强:通过在不同的位置或设备上备份数据,企业可以在一个备份出现故障时,依然能够从另一个备份中恢复数据,从而最大限度地减少业务中断时间

    这对于维持企业运营的连续性和客户满意度至关重要

     数据安全性加强:双备份不仅能够防止数据丢失,还能在一定程度上抵御网络攻击和恶意软件的数据窃取风险

    即使一个备份被攻破或篡改,另一个备份仍然可以作为恢复数据的可靠来源

     二、数据库文件双备份的实施策略 实现数据库文件双备份需要综合考虑备份设备、备份位置、备份频率以及备份策略等多个方面

    以下是一些常见的实施策略: 1.选择合适的备份设备:备份设备可以是硬盘、磁带、光盘等传统存储设备,也可以是云存储等现代存储解决方案

    在选择备份设备时,企业需要权衡成本、性能、可靠性和可扩展性等因素

    例如,硬盘备份具有读写速度快、容量大的优点,但可能受到物理损坏或数据丢失的风险;而云备份则提供了更高的灵活性和可扩展性,但可能需要支付额外的存储费用

     2.确定备份位置:备份位置的选择同样至关重要

    为了确保数据的安全性和可用性,企业应将备份数据存储在远离主数据中心的位置,以避免单点故障的影响

    同时,备份位置还应具备良好的物理安全性和网络环境,以便在需要时能够迅速访问和恢复数据

     3.制定备份频率:备份频率应根据数据的更新速度和业务的重要性来确定

    对于关键业务系统和频繁更新的数据,企业应实施更频繁的备份策略,如每小时或每天备份一次

    而对于不常更新的数据,则可以降低备份频率以节省存储空间和资源

     4.采用多种备份策略:为了实现更全面的数据保护,企业可以采用多种备份策略相结合的方式

    例如,可以结合全量备份、增量备份和差异备份等多种备份类型,以及定时备份、实时备份和触发备份等多种备份模式

    这些策略的组合使用可以进一步提高数据的可靠性和可用性

     三、数据库文件双备份的具体实现方法 数据库文件双备份的具体实现方法因数据库类型和备份需求而异

    以下以MySQL数据库为例,介绍几种常见的双备份实现方法: 1.使用MySQL自带的备份工具:MySQL提供了多种备份工具,如mysqldump、mysqlbackup等

    这些工具可以方便地实现数据库的全量备份和增量备份

    为了实现双备份,企业可以将备份数据分别存储在不同的位置或设备上

    例如,可以使用mysqldump工具将数据库备份到本地硬盘,并将备份文件复制到远程服务器或云存储上

     2.利用复制和同步技术:MySQL支持主从复制和主主复制等多种复制技术

    通过配置复制关系,企业可以将主数据库的数据实时同步到从数据库上

    为了实现双备份,可以将从数据库部署在不同的物理位置或设备上

    当主数据库发生故障时,可以迅速切换到从数据库上继续提供服务

     3.结合第三方备份软件:除了MySQL自带的备份工具外,还可以使用第三方备份软件来实现数据库的双备份

    这些软件通常提供了更丰富的备份选项和更强大的数据恢复能力

    例如,一些备份软件支持定时备份、自动清理过期备份文件、数据压缩和加密等功能

    通过结合这些软件,企业可以更方便地实现数据库的双备份策略

     四、数据库文件双备份的案例分析 以下是一个关于数据库文件双备份的案例分析,以帮助企业更好地理解这一策略的实际应用效果

     案例背景:某金融企业拥有大量的客户数据和交易记录,这些数据对于企业的运营和客户信任至关重要

    然而,由于硬件故障和网络攻击等风险的存在,企业面临着数据丢失和泄露的严峻挑战

    为了保障数据的安全性和可用性,企业决定实施数据库文件双备份策略

     实施方案:企业选择了MySQL数据库作为数据存储平台,并结合了多种备份方法和工具来实现双备份

    首先,企业使用了MySQL自带的mysqldump工具进行全量备份,并将备份文件存储在本地硬盘上

    其次,企业配置了MySQL的主从复制关系,将从数据库部署在远程服务器上

    这样,当主数据库发生故障时,企业可以迅速切换到从数据库上继续提供服务

    此外,企业还使用了第三方备份软件来定时备份数据库,并将备份文件存储到云存储上

    这些备份文件可以作为恢复数据的最后一道防线

     实施效果:通过实施数据库文件双备份策略,该金融企业成功地提高了数据的可靠性和可用性

    在一次硬件故障中,主数据库无法访问,但企业迅速切换到了从数据库上继续提供服务,确保了业务的连续性

    同时,在另一次网络攻击中,虽然部分备份文件被篡改,但企业仍然能够从其他备份源中恢复数据,避免了数据丢失和泄露的风险

     五、数据库文件双备份的挑战与解决方案 尽管数据库文件双备份策略具有诸多优点,但在实施过程中仍然面临一些挑战

    以下是一些常见的挑战及相应的解决方案: 1.成本问题:双备份需要额外的存储设备和网络资源,从而增加了企业的运营成本

    为了降低成本,企业可以选择成本效益更高的存储解决方案,如云存储等

    同时,通过优化备份策略和频率,也可以在一定程度上减少存储资源的消耗

     2.数据一致性问题:在双备份过程中,如何确保备份数据与主数据的一致性是一个重要问题

    为了解决这一问题,企业可以采用实时同步或定时同步的方式,确保备份数据能够及时反映主数据的最新状态

    此外,还可以使用校验和等技术来验证备份数据的完整性

     3.备份恢复效率问题:在数据丢失或故障发生时,如何快速恢复数据是企业关注的焦点

    为了提高备份恢复的效率,企业可以提前制定详细的恢复计划和流程,并进行定期的备份恢复测试

    同时,还可以选择支持快速恢复的备份软件和工具来缩短恢复时间

     六、结论 数据库文件双备份策略是企业保障数据安全的重要手段之一

    通过在不同的位置或设备上备份数据库文件和日志文件,企业可以有效地防止单点故障导致的数据丢失或不可用风险

    在实施过程中,企业需要综合考虑备份设备、备份位置、备份频率以及备份策略等多个方面,以确保双备份策略的有效性和可靠性

    同时,企业还需要关注成本问题、数据一致性问题以及备份恢复效率问题等挑战,并采取相应的解决方案来优化双备份策略的实施效果

    只有这样,企业才能在日益激烈的市场竞争中立于不败之地,确保业务的持续稳定和客户的信任支持

    

MySQL连接就这么简单!本地远程、编程语言连接方法一网打尽
还在为MySQL日期计算头疼?这份加一天操作指南能解决90%问题
MySQL日志到底在哪里?Linux/Windows/macOS全平台查找方法在此
MySQL数据库管理工具全景评测:从Workbench到DBeaver的技术选型指南
MySQL密码忘了怎么办?这份重置指南能救急,Windows/Linux/Mac都适用
你的MySQL为什么经常卡死?可能是锁表在作怪!快速排查方法在此
MySQL单表卡爆怎么办?从策略到实战,一文掌握「分表」救命技巧
清空MySQL数据表千万别用错!DELETE和TRUNCATE这个区别可能导致重大事故
你的MySQL中文排序一团糟?记住这几点,轻松实现准确拼音排序!
别再混淆Hive和MySQL了!读懂它们的天壤之别,才算摸到大数据的门道